Director Mindset: Cách viết một System Prompt định hình 'nhân cách' và giới hạn hành vi của Agent
Hướng dẫn chi tiết kỹ thuật viết System Prompt chuẩn doanh nghiệp. Cách định hình nhân cách, kiểm soát giới hạn hành vi và loại bỏ 100% từ ngữ sáo rỗng của AI.

TL;DR: Hướng dẫn chi tiết kỹ thuật viết System Prompt chuẩn doanh nghiệp. Cách định hình nhân cách, kiểm soát giới hạn hành vi và loại bỏ 100% từ ngữ sáo rỗng của AI bằng triết lý Director Mindset.
Director Mindset: Cách viết một System Prompt định hình 'nhân cách' và giới hạn hành vi của Agent
Hầu hết mọi người khi ra lệnh cho AI đều viết ở dạng hội thoại thông thường (User Prompt). Ví dụ: "Hãy viết giúp tôi một bài đăng Facebook quảng bá sản phẩm A". Cách làm này giống như việc bạn tuyển một nhân viên mới vào và chỉ nói: "Làm việc đi" mà không cung cấp bản mô tả công việc, không giới hạn quyền hạn và cũng không có tiêu chuẩn đánh giá.
Trong thiết kế hệ thống AI Agent chuyên nghiệp, System Prompt chính là "Bản mô tả công việc + Nội quy lao động" mà bạn áp đặt lên mô hình AI.
Với triết lý Director Mindset (Tư duy của người đạo diễn), bạn không thể chỉ mong đợi AI tự thông minh. Bạn phải định hình "nhân cách", giới hạn hành vi và cung cấp bộ lọc ngôn từ cho Agent ngay từ cấp độ hệ thống. Dưới đây là cách chúng tôi thiết kế một System Prompt chuẩn công nghiệp để AI Agent vận hành an toàn và chất lượng nhất.
4 Thành phần bắt buộc của một System Prompt chuẩn doanh nghiệp
System Prompt là gì và tại sao nó quan trọng?
System Prompt là chỉ dẫn cốt lõi được cấu hình ở mức hệ thống cho AI trước khi nhận bất kỳ yêu cầu nào từ người dùng. Một System Prompt chuẩn bắt buộc phải chứa 4 thành phần: (1) Vai trò & Nhân cách (Role & Persona), (2) Phạm vi nhiệm vụ (Tasks), (3) Các giới hạn hành vi nghiêm ngặt (Constraints), và (4) Tiêu chuẩn định dạng đầu ra (Output Format).
Nếu thiếu đi 1 trong 4 thành phần này, Agent sẽ hoạt động thiếu nhất quán và rất dễ bị ảo tưởng (hallucination) khi gặp context dài.

Template System Prompt thực chiến (Copy & Paste)
Dưới đây là cấu trúc System Prompt mà chúng tôi áp dụng để xây dựng các Agent viết nội dung tại TVT Agency. Prompt này được viết bằng Markdown để AI dễ dàng phân loại cấu trúc thông tin:
# ROLE & PERSONA
Bạn là một Senior Content Specialist tại TVT Agency, có 10 năm kinh nghiệm trong lĩnh vực content marketing cho SME Việt Nam.
Phong cách viết của bạn: Thực chiến, đi thẳng vào số liệu, không hoa mỹ, giọng văn đĩnh đạc của một chuyên gia vận hành hệ thống (Quiet Authority).
# CONSTRAINTS (GIỚI HẠN CỨNG - BẮT BUỘC TUÂN THỦ)
1. Tuyệt đối KHÔNG sử dụng các từ ngữ sáo rỗng của AI (AI Slop) như: "trong kỷ nguyên số", "giải pháp đột phá", "hãy cùng khám phá", "chìa khóa thành công".
2. Nếu không biết chắc thông tin, trả lời: "Tôi không có đủ dữ liệu sạch để kết luận" - Không bao giờ tự bịa số liệu.
3. Luôn sử dụng nguyên lý "Show, Don't Tell" (Đưa số liệu, case study cụ thể thay vì nhận xét chung chung).
4. Phải viết bằng tiếng Việt tự nhiên, Vietnamese subset chuẩn, không dịch word-by-word từ tiếng Anh.
# DETAILED TASKS
- Đọc brief đầu vào từ người dùng.
- Lập cấu trúc bài viết với hệ thống H2, H3 cụ thể.
- Đảm bảo mỗi thẻ H2 dạng câu hỏi luôn có 1 block "Direct Q&A" (1-2 câu trả lời trực diện) ngay phía dưới trước khi phân tích sâu.
# OUTPUT FORMAT
- Định dạng bằng Markdown chuẩn.
- Sử dụng các bảng biểu (Markdown tables) khi so sánh thông số.
- Sử dụng trích dẫn (Blockquotes `>`) cho các thông tin quan trọng.
Phân tích sâu tư duy thiết kế System Prompt
1. Định hình "Nhân cách" (Persona) để kiểm soát giọng văn
Nếu bạn chỉ nói "Hãy viết một bài văn", AI sẽ lấy giọng trung bình cộng của internet — một kiểu giọng văn vô hồn, giống như robot dịch thuật. Bằng cách định nghĩa: "Senior Content Specialist... giọng văn đĩnh đạc (Quiet Authority)", bạn đã thu hẹp không gian phân phối xác suất của mô hình, ép nó chọn những từ vựng mang tính chuyên nghiệp và thực chiến hơn.
2. Thiết lập "Giới hạn" (Constraints) để chặn lỗi hệ thống
Đây là phần quan trọng nhất của System Prompt. Trong lập trình AI, việc cấm (Negative Prompting) luôn mang lại hiệu quả rõ ràng hơn việc khuyên bảo. Hãy liệt kê rõ danh sách những từ ngữ sáo rỗng mà bạn không muốn xuất hiện. Khi AI viết, cơ chế chú ý (Attention Mechanism) của nó sẽ quét qua phần cấm này và chủ động loại bỏ các từ khoá rác.
3. Quy chuẩn cấu hình định dạng đầu ra (Output Format)
AI rất giỏi tuân thủ cấu trúc nếu được định nghĩa rõ ràng. Hãy yêu cầu nó xuất ra định dạng Markdown chuẩn, chỉ định rõ khi nào cần dùng bảng so sánh, khi nào dùng blockquote. Điều này giúp các hệ thống tự động hoá (như Make.com hoặc Node.js script) dễ dàng trích xuất thông tin đầu ra mà không sợ sai lệch định dạng.
Lời khuyên khi tối ưu hóa Prompt
"Đừng cố viết một System Prompt dài 10 trang. AI sẽ bị quá tải thông tin và bỏ qua các chỉ dẫn ở giữa. Hãy giữ prompt cô đọng dưới 1000 từ và tập trung tối đa vào phần Constraints."
Hãy luôn test System Prompt của bạn với ít nhất 10 kịch bản test case khác nhau trước khi đưa vào chạy production. Khi phát hiện một lỗi lặp đi lặp lại, hãy cập nhật lỗi đó trực tiếp vào phần # CONSTRAINTS của prompt. Đó chính là cách bạn huấn luyện và duy trì độ ổn định cho AI Agent của doanh nghiệp mình.
Đọc tiếp
Sẵn sàng build sản phẩm thật bằng AI?
Khóa học Vibe Coding — 3 buổi Zoom thực chiến. Từ Zero đến Production với Claude Code.
Bài Liên Quan

Prompt Engineering tiếng Việt cho FPT.ai

Tại sao tôi từ bỏ viết code truyền thống để chuyển sang Vibe Coding hoàn toàn?
